"I used to go here from 1997-1999. My 2nd grade teacher was Mrs.Brown; 3rd grade Mrs. Smith, and 4th grade Mrs. Hall. 3rd and 4th grade I had class in the portables, and for 4th grade, since my brother and I were in the same grade, he had Mr. Hall which was Mrs. Hall’s husband. I wonder if any of my old teachers are still there. I highly doubt it since it’s been 20 years, but it would be cool if any of them were still there. I actually had my first kiss at this school. I was in 2nd grade, and my girlfriend and I kissed under one of the portables’ ramp. I used to love going to school here. The two things I hated was that the monitor, Miss Paine, treated the kids horrible. She would yell at everyone, make kids stand in timeout, and if you were late to class, she would make you run laps around the school. Also, one of the teachers, Mr. Cardova, had this cactus that if you said a bad word, or got in trouble, he would make you kiss it. If he didn’t make you do that, he would make you jump up and down for several minutes as your punishment. It sounds crazy, but it’s actually true. Back in the 90’s, they didn’t care as much. Teachers and monitors got away with anything."
